How they compare

Kazakhstan currently reports 24,181 kt against 23,074 kt in Iraq, a difference of 1,107 kt.

The two have swapped places 1 time across 32 shared years of data; in 1992 it was Iraq ahead.

Iraq ranks 40th and Kazakhstan ranks 38th of 244 countries.

Across the 4 decades both report, Iraq averaged higher in 3 and Kazakhstan in 1.

The FAOSTAT domain on Emissions from Pre- and post- agricultural production includes the greenhouse gas (GHG) emissions, and related activity data, generated from pre- and post-agriculture production stages of the agri-food syst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). The domain includes methane (CH4), nitrous oxide (N2O), carbon dioxide (CO2) and CO2 equivalent (CO2eq) emissions from the above activities as well as the aggregate fluorinated gases (F-gases) emissions. Estimates are available by country, with global coverage and are updated annually.The FAOSTAT domain disseminates information estimates of CH4, N2O, CO2 emissions, F-gases, their aggregates in CO2eq in units of kilotonnes (kt, or 10^6 kg), and the underlying activity data. CO2eq emissions are computed by using the IPCC Fifth Assessment report global warming potentials, AR5 (IPCC, 2014). Data are available for most countries and territories, for standard FAOSTAT regional aggregations, and for Annex I and non-Annex I country groups.
